ben Lodge
Ben accepts briefs in criminal and disciplinary matters, regulatory proceedings, civil and commercial litigation, and public law.
Before joining the Bar, Ben worked for a Commonwealth regulator where he was involved in litigation before the Federal Court and Federal Circuit and Family Court involving contraventions of employment and industrial legislation. He also worked at the Office of the Director of Public Prosecutions (SA) where he acted in significant criminal trials and appeals.
Ben has appeared as junior counsel in trials before the Supreme Court, and as presenting counsel in trials before the District Court and Magistrates Court. He has also appeared in contested hearings before the Supreme, District and Magistrates Courts, and in interlocutory and civil penalty hearings in the Federal Circuit and Family Court.
Ben is experienced in appellate matters. He has appeared as both presenting counsel and junior counsel in the Court of Appeal, and as junior counsel in a number of hearings in the High Court of Australia.
